  • The opportunity

  • This is an employed role, based around the Shifnal area.
     
    What's in it for you?
     
    • Basic salary of £40,000 to £45,000 - £80,000 OTE
    • Leads/Client bank provided
    • Four day working week
    This role is for one of our Partnership firms, who firmly believe that understanding your finances allows you to make informed choices. They want each of their clients to achieve their life goals and to plan for their present, and their future, working with them long term to ensure their plans remain on track. Their way of working offers a positive flexible working culture, a four day working week, with leads provided.

    This is a hybrid role, servicing existing clients around the areas of Telford and Shrewsbury and you would need to be based within reasonable commuting distance of the office in Shifnal.  You will be seeing clients remotely and face-to-face meetings and will benefit from having access to a comprehensive administrative support service and will be part of a top performing team with an outstanding reputation in the market. 

    What you’ll be getting involved in:
     
    • Fulfilling ongoing servicing requirements to existing clients, carrying out reviews relating to pensions and investments
    • Carrying out remote meetings and establishing client requirements
    • Liaising effectively with the administrative team to ensure all paperwork is completed and records are up to date 
    • Delivering an excellent level of service on all financial advice, and working with clients to achieve excellent customer outcomes
    • Ascertaining the future financial planning needs of clients 
    • Keeping up to date with all industry knowledge and market developments
    • Partaking in ongoing training and CPD 
    • Obtaining client referrals and growing the client base to enable future development
    • Meeting all regulatory requirements and working in line with FCA and industry standards
  • What will you need to succeed?


    • Level 4 Diploma in Financial Advice essential
    • At least two years experience as a Financial Adviser
    • Customer facing experience and used to exceeding customer expectations
    • Up to date with industry developments, news and advancements
    • A positive, driven, and most importantly, customer-centric approach to Financial Advice
